From: Jens Axboe Date: Fri, 8 Apr 2022 18:46:44 +0000 (-0600) Subject: iolog: Use %llu for 64-bit X-Git-Tag: test-tag-2022-08-09~66 X-Git-Url: https://git.kernel.dk/?a=commitdiff_plain;h=6d01ac19170fadaf46a6db6b4cc347f1b389f422;p=fio.git iolog: Use %llu for 64-bit The previous fix was a bit dump, we need %llu on 32-bit. Fi that and the cast. Fixes: 11cb686eeda8 ("iolog: fix warning for 32-bit compilation") Signed-off-by: Jens Axboe --- diff --git a/iolog.c b/iolog.c index 42d2b0e9..37e799a1 100644 --- a/iolog.c +++ b/iolog.c @@ -47,10 +47,10 @@ void log_io_u(const struct thread_data *td, const struct io_u *io_u) return; fio_gettime(&now, NULL); - fprintf(td->iolog_f, "%lu %s %s %llu %llu\n", - (unsigned long) utime_since_now(&td->io_log_start_time), - io_u->file->file_name, io_ddir_name(io_u->ddir), - io_u->offset, io_u->buflen); + fprintf(td->iolog_f, "%llu %s %s %llu %llu\n", + (unsigned long long) utime_since_now(&td->io_log_start_time), + io_u->file->file_name, io_ddir_name(io_u->ddir), io_u->offset, + io_u->buflen); } @@ -73,9 +73,9 @@ void log_file(struct thread_data *td, struct fio_file *f, return; fio_gettime(&now, NULL); - fprintf(td->iolog_f, "%lu %s %s\n", - (unsigned long) utime_since_now(&td->io_log_start_time), - f->file_name, act[what]); + fprintf(td->iolog_f, "%llu %s %s\n", + (unsigned long long) utime_since_now(&td->io_log_start_time), + f->file_name, act[what]); } static void iolog_delay(struct thread_data *td, unsigned long delay)